With RegSeeker you can easily search, view and clean your registry. RegSeeker can search(parts of) the registry and view, delete or export the search results from a handy list. RegSeeker can display a list of installed applications, startup entries, color schemes, and several histories(IE URLs - including index.dat; run; map network drive; find files; recently opened files). It also contains a list of'tweaks' to change hidden options of the Windows GUI. You can also maintain a list of favorite registry entries.
RegSeeker's registry cleaner searches the registry for errors, including unused extensions, unused filetypes, unused entries, unknown paths, invalid CLSIDs(ActiveX/COM), obsolete entries, obsolete start menu items, missing DLLs, and missing help files. You can select which errors you'd like to fix and create a backup of the registry before you do so.
